Uzzo Command file: 02.12.19.16:22:31.cmd.log 02.12.20.18:51:29.cmd.log Activity: --------- 1) Observation of an Equatorial Coronal Hole Sequence: 02.12_hole1.tcl SCI_SPEC: Characterization of an equatorial coronal hole. Goal is to measure the properties of a non-polar coronal hole. In particular we are interested in the coronal conditions (intensities and line widths for HI Ly-alpha and OVI 1032/1037) as a function of height and latitude. We will compare these properties with the ones found in polar coronal holes. Roll positions are VL-corrected for PA=257 degrees.
